Browns weigh re-signing Bush, eye Elliss as backup option

In the NFL free-agency frame, the Browns are considering re-signing LB Devin Bush and eyeing LB Kaden Elliss as a backup option, while navigating departures (Wyatt Teller, David Njoku) and a potential return by Joel Bitonio; PFF projections estimate Elliss at three years, about $36 million with $21 million guaranteed, with Bush projected to a similar deal but with different guarantees, signaling possible defensive changes this offseason.

NFL Players Discuss Contract Decisions and Dream Teammates

Former Pittsburgh Steelers linebacker Devin Bush said he doesn't know why the team didn't pick up his fifth-year option, but he's excited for the opportunity with the Seattle Seahawks. Bush struggled after a promising rookie season and a torn ACL in year two. He didn't improve much in 2022 and wasn't a fan favorite in Pittsburgh. The Steelers have completely overhauled their inside linebacker room this offseason.

Seahawks add defensive talent with signings of Devin Bush and Lonnie Johnson Jr.

The Seattle Seahawks have signed former Pittsburgh Steelers linebacker Devin Bush to a one-year deal. The 24-year-old was selected with the No. 10 overall pick in the 2019 NFL Draft and has recorded impressive stats in his career so far. With the Seahawks' inside linebacker position being an area of concern, Bush is expected to fit in alongside Jordyn Brooks in the middle. Seahawks Bolster Defense with Signing of Devin Bush and Lonnie Johnson Jr.

Linebacker Devin Bush, who was released by the Pittsburgh Steelers, has reportedly signed a one-year contract with the Seattle Seahawks in the ongoing NFL free agency. The Seahawks have been active in the free agency, adding Dre’Mont Jones, Jarran Reed, and Evan Brown to their roster. With Cody Barton's departure and Jordyn Brooks' unavailability, linebacker was a position of concern for the Seahawks.
